Woody Allen Reflects on a Lucky Life as He Premieres His 50th Film

Background

US director Woody Allen premiered his 50th film, “Coup de Chance,” at the Venice Film Festival on September 4, 2023. Despite the controversies that have surrounded him in recent years, Allen chose to focus on his luck and good fortune during his press appearances, making no reference to the scandals that have dogged his latter years.

A Life of Good Fortune

During his interview with reporters, Allen expressed gratitude for the fortunate life he has led. He attributed his luck to having loving parents, good friends, a wonderful wife, and a successful marriage. He also mentioned that he has never been hospitalized or experienced any significant hardships. At almost 88 years old, Allen considers himself fortunate to have lived a life free from major adversities.

Turbulent Personal Life

Woody Allen’s personal life has been marred by controversy and scandal. In the 1990s, he made headlines for his relationship and subsequent marriage to Soon-Yi Previn, the adopted daughter of his former lover, Mia Farrow. Additionally, Allen has faced accusations of sexual abuse by his adopted daughter, Dylan Farrow. Allen has consistently denied these allegations, and no charges have ever been filed against him.

Supporting #MeToo Movement

While Allen expressed support for the #MeToo movement, which has brought attention to sexual misconduct in the entertainment industry, he also cautioned against going to extremes. He believed that the movement, at times, could become “silly” when taken too far.

Critical Reception and Protests at Venice Film Festival

The Venice Film Festival received criticism for granting Allen a prestigious slot for the premiere of his film. A small group of protesters demonstrated on the red carpet, calling him an abuser. Despite the commotion, the red carpet arrivals continued without interruption, and the protesters were eventually removed by the police.

The Language of Inspiration

Despite not being able to speak French, Allen decided to make “Coup de Chance” in French, drawing inspiration from European filmmakers who have influenced his work. He equated the importance of good acting in any language to be able to convey realistic and natural emotions, rather than relying on dramatic and exaggerated performances.

Reflections on Death and Future Projects

Addressing the themes of love, adultery, and death in his film, Allen stated that death is inevitable, and there is nothing one can do about it. He advised against dwelling on it too much as it is a “bad deal” that one is stuck with.

Allen also discussed the possibility of “Coup de Chance” being his final movie. However, he revealed that he had a good idea for a story set in his native New York and expressed his willingness to make it if he could find a backer who would accept his terms, including not reading the script or knowing the cast beforehand.
